Learning Task 3:
padilas [110]

Answer:

Area = x^2- 25

Area =9x^2 +24x + 16

Length = (3x -2)

Speed = \left(y^2-3y+1\right)

Product = 3m^3 + 6m^2 - 6m

Step-by-step explanation:

Solving (1):

Length = (x + 5)

Width = (x - 5)

Required

Calculate Area

Area = Length * Width

Area = (x + 5) * (x - 5)

Area = x^2 + 5x - 5x - 25

Area = x^2- 25

Solving (2):

Given

Length = (3x + 4)

Required: Calculate Area

Area =Length * Length

Area =(3x + 4) * (3x + 4)

Area =9x^2 + 12x + 12x + 16

Area =9x^2 +24x + 16

Solving (3):

Area = 3x^2 + 7x - 6

Width = x + 3

Required: Calculate Length

Area = Length * Width

Length = \frac{Area}{Width}

Length = \frac{3x^2 + 7x - 6}{x + 3}

Factorize the numerator

Length = \frac{3x^2 + 9x -2x - 6}{x + 3}

Length = \frac{3x(x + 3) -2(x + 3)}{x + 3}

Length = \frac{(3x -2) (x + 3)}{x + 3}

Divide by x + 3

Length = (3x -2)

Solving (4):

Distance = (2y^3 - 7y^2 + 5y -1)

Time = 2y - 1

Required: Determine the average speed

This is calculated as:

Speed = \frac{Distance}{Time}

Speed = \frac{2y^3 - 7y^2 + 5y -1}{2y - 1}

Factorize the numerator

Speed = \frac{\left(2y-1\right)\left(y^2-3y+1\right)}{2y - 1}

Speed = \left(y^2-3y+1\right)

Solving (5):

Multiply (m^2 + 2m - 2) by sum of (m + 3) and (2m - 3)

First, calculate the sum:

Sum = m + 3 + 2m - 3

Sum = m +  2m+3 - 3

Sum = 3m

Then, the product

Product = (m^2 + 2m - 2)(3m)

Product = 3m^3 + 6m^2 - 6m

What is a simpler form of the expression?<br><br> (2n^2 + 5n +3)(4n - 5)
coldgirl [10]

Answer:

8n³ + 10n² - 13n - 15

Step-by-step explanation:

Distribute the factors by multiplying each term in the first factor by each term in the second factor, that is

4n(2n² + 5n + 3) - 5(2n² + 5n + 3) ← distribute both parenthesis

= 8n³ + 20n² + 12n - 10n² - 25n - 15 ← collect like terms

= 8n³ + 10n² - 13n - 15
